Key Responsibilities
  • Oversee daily office operations and streamline internal workflows
  • Manage HR-related tasks such as timesheets, PTO, and rotating on-call schedules
  • Coordinate onboarding processes and prepare new hire documentation and tools
  • Manage permits and building documentation with local municipalities
  • Maintain inventory and order office supplies
  • Generate and deliver monthly/quarterly department performance reports
  • Track tenant-billable work orders and ensure accurate CRM submissions
  • Conduct weekly check-ins and coordinate team communications and follow-ups
  • Submit internal reports and contractor payment requests to ownership
  • Monitor timekeeping systems and mobile clock-ins for accuracy
  • Plan team appreciation events and manage employee rewards program
  • Lead recruitment efforts for open roles within the department
